Antioch Thanksgiving Weekend Weather: A Rainy Start and Finish, But Otherwise Dry and Cool

Rain may make for a messy Wednesday travel day in Antioch, but things clear out for most of the long weekend.

ANTIOCH, TN — A largely dry weekend is bookended by rain chances, according to the National Weather Service forecast for Antioch and South Nashville. A good chance of showers Wednesday clears out by noon Thursday, setting up a dry weekend before rain chances return for the work week.

Wednesday night: A 50 percent chance of showers, otherwise cloudy, low of 53.

Thanksgiving: A 20 percent chance of showers before noon, then mostly cloudy, a high of 62. A mostly cloudy night with a low of 45.

Black Friday: Partly sunny, high of 63. Partly cloudy in the evening with a low of 35.

Saturday: Sunny, high of 62. Clear overnight, low of 32.

Sunday: Mostly sunny with a high of 62. Mostly cloudy overnight with a 40 percent chance of showers after midnight, low of 46.
